Frequently Asked Questions about Houston Apartments with Swimming Pool

What is the Cheapest Swimming Pool apartment in Houston?

Currently the most affordable Apartment in Houston with Swimming Pool is at Filament listed at $396.

How much is the average rent for Houston Apartments with Swimming Pool?

The average rent for a Apartment in Houston with Swimming Pool is $1,872.

What is the largest Houston Apartment for rent with Swimming Pool?

Today's Apartment with Swimming Pool and the most square footage in Houston is a 4,450 square feet unit starting from $2,230 at The Museum Tower.

What is the average size for Houston Apartments for rent with Swimming Pool?

The average size for a rental with Swimming Pool in Houston is currently at 656 sq ft.
